I have installed Red Hat Linux 7.3 with ext2 file system and I have multiple
partition. I converted them to ext3 using following command.
tune2fs -j -i 0 /dev/hdaX
And I modified /etc/fstab as below.
LABEL=/ / ext3 defaults 1 1
LABEL=/boot /boot ext3 defaults 1 2
none /dev/pts devpts gid=5,mode=620 0 0
LABEL=/home /home ext3 defaults 1 2
none /proc proc defaults 0 0
none /dev/shm tmpfs defaults 0 0
LABEL=/var /var ext3 defaults 1 2
/dev/hda5 swap swap defaults 0 0
After I rebooted the system, I found / partition still was mounted as ext2.
[root at ProEIM root]# cat /proc/mounts
rootfs / rootfs rw 0 0
/dev/root / ext2 rw 0 0 # not mounted as ext3
/proc /proc proc rw 0 0
usbdevfs /proc/bus/usb usbdevfs rw 0 0
/dev/hda1 /boot ext3 rw 0 0
none /dev/pts devpts rw 0 0
/dev/hda6 /home ext3 rw 0 0
none /dev/shm tmpfs rw 0 0
/dev/hda2 /var ext3 rw 0 0
[root at ProEIM root]#
But it is ext3 when I use df -T.
[root at ProEIM root]# df -T
Filesystem Type 1k-blocks Used Available Use% Mounted on
/dev/hda3 ext3 5036316 335784 4444700 8% /
/dev/hda1 ext3 101089 8724 87146 10% /boot
/dev/hda6 ext3 66263252 466552 62430684 1% /home
none tmpfs 127416 0 127416 0% /dev/shm
/dev/hda2 ext3 5036316 101656 4678828 3% /var
[root at ProEIM root]#
How can I convert / partition from ext2 to ext3? Please help me.
